
Urbino, Italy
International students pursuing postgraduate studies at the University of Urbino Carlo Bo typically need a Bachelor's degree, English or Italian language proficiency (depending on the course), transcripts, a CV, a personal statement, and possibly a research proposal. Program-specific requirements vary (e.g., PhDs often require interviews/projects). Academic records, language proof, a CV, and occasionally the GRE or GMAT are important documents. The uniurb.it website also provides specific program criteria, such as research projects or thesis abstracts, along with deadlines and comprehensive calls for applications.
